The mask is connected to a plastic reservoir bag filled with a high concentration of oxygen. The mask has a one-way valve system that prevents exhaled oxygen from mixing with the oxygen in the reservoir bag. When you inhale, you breathe in oxygen from the reservoir bag. Exhaled air escapes through vents in the side of the mask and goes back into the atmosphere. Non-rebreather masks allow you to receive a higher concentration of oxygen than with standard masks.

Disruptions in airflow can lead to suffocation. A healthcare provider usually remains in attendance during use of this type mask. A partial rebreather mask looks similar to a non-rebreather mask but contains a two-way valve between the mask and reservoir bag. The valve allows some of your breath back into the reservoir bag. Both types of masks may be used in emergency situations. A medical professional will determine which mask to use based on your specific condition. A simple face mask is usually used to deliver a low to moderate amount of oxygen.

A simple mask contains holes on the sides to let exhaled air through and to prevent suffocation in case of a blockage. A medical professional will make a decision of which type of oxygen delivery system is needed based on the specific condition being treated and blood oxygen levels.

Non-rebreathing masks are not available for home use. A non-rebreathing mask is meant for short-term use in situations such as transporting people to a hospital. A doctor may recommend home oxygen therapy to people with long-term conditions like chronic obtrusive pulmonary disease , severe asthma , or cystic fibrosis. Home oxygen therapy can be delivered through oxygen tanks or an oxygen concentrator.

It may also be administered through a face mask. Non-rebreathing masks are used to deliver high concentrations of oxygen in emergency situations.

These masks may be used for traumatic injuries , after smoke inhalation, and in cases of carbon monoxide poisoning. The simple face mask is a variable performance oxygen delivery device, which is sometimes referred to as a Hudson mask intended for short-term use, such as post-op recovery Olive The simple face mask is made of plastic and shaped to fit over the mouth and nose with a port at the bottom for the connection of oxygen tubing Figure 1.

Oxygen is delivered into the mask and air entrained from the atmosphere through side ports, so that the concentration of delivered oxygen depends on the amount of air drawn in through the mask by the patient. Due to the unpredictable levels of actual oxygenation, this mask is not suitable where the patient requires accurate low dose oxygen therapy owing to respiratory disease or where there is a risk of carbon dioxide retention, but it may be appropriate at times where high levels of oxygen are required.
